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V: Battery Pack and Performance

Performance is one of the biggest highlights of both electric SUVs. Tata Motors offers multiple battery pack options for both models, but the biggest difference appears in their flagship Quad Wheel Drive variants.

Key ComparisonTata Sierra EVTata Harrier EV
Battery Options63 kWh & 75 kWh65 kWh & 75 kWh
Drive TypeRWD / QWDRWD / QWD
Single Motor Power234 bhp / 206.5 bhp234.67 bhp
QWD Power302 bhp390 bhp
Peak Torque504 Nm504 Nm

Tata Sierra EV

The Sierra EV is available with two battery packs. The entry-level 63 kWh battery delivers 234 bhp and 315 Nm through a Rear-Wheel Drive configuration. Buyers opting for the larger 75 kWh battery also get a single-motor setup, producing 206.5 bhp and 315 Nm.

The highlight is undoubtedly the QWD variant, where dual electric motors combine to generate approximately 302 bhp and 504 Nm of torque. The setup promises strong highway performance while remaining efficient enough for long-distance touring.

Tata Harrier EV

The Harrier EV follows a similar battery strategy with 65 kWh and 75 kWh battery packs. Both Rear-Wheel Drive variants produce around 234.67 bhp and 315 Nm.

However, the flagship Harrier EV QWD raises the performance bar significantly. Its dual-motor system produces an impressive 390 bhp and 504 Nm of torque, making it one of the most powerful electric SUVs currently available from an Indian manufacturer.

Performance Verdict

If outright performance and quick acceleration are your priorities, the Harrier EV clearly takes the lead. It offers nearly 88 bhp more power than the Sierra EV while maintaining the same torque output. However, buyers who prefer a balanced mix of performance and efficiency will find the Sierra EV more than capable for everyday driving and highway cruising.

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V: Which EV Goes Farther?

For most EV buyers, driving range is just as important as performance. This is where the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V comparison becomes even more interesting.

Electric SUVFull-Charge Driving Range
Tata Sierra EV665 km
Tata Harrier EV622 km

Despite using a similar 75 kWh battery in their top variants, the Sierra EV delivers a higher claimed driving range of 665 km, compared to 622 km in the Harrier EV.

One possible reason is the different tuning philosophy. While the Harrier EV prioritizes maximum performance with its 390 bhp output, the Sierra EV adopts a slightly more efficiency-focused approach. The result is 43 km of additional claimed range, which can make a noticeable difference during long road trips or intercity travel.

Range Verdict

If your daily routine includes long-distance driving or frequent highway journeys, the Tata Sierra EV is the better choice thanks to its longer claimed range and improved efficiency.

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V: Features and Cabin Experience

Both electric SUVs are loaded with premium features, but they appeal to different types of buyers.

Tata Sierra EV: Futuristic and Lifestyle-Focused

The Sierra EV introduces one of the most distinctive interiors in its segment with a triple-screen dashboard layout. It combines a 10.24-inch digital instrument cluster, a 12.3-inch infotainment touchscreen, and a dedicated 12.3-inch passenger display, creating a truly futuristic cabin experience.

Other key features include:

  • Ventilated front seats
  • Electrically adjustable driver’s seat
  • Head-Up Display (HUD)
  • 540-degree surround-view camera
  • Six terrain modes
  • Boost Mode
  • Connected car technology
  • Premium interior finish

The Sierra EV is designed for buyers who value comfort, technology, and a unique cabin experience.

Tata Harrier EV: Technology Meets Luxury

The Harrier EV takes a different approach by focusing on advanced driver assistance and premium convenience features. It comes equipped with a massive 14.5-inch infotainment system, giving the dashboard a clean and premium appearance.

Its feature list includes:

  • Level 2 ADAS
  • Blind Spot View Monitor
  • Auto Park Assist
  • Remote Summon Mode
  • Ventilated front seats
  • Six-way powered driver’s seat
  • Four-way powered co-driver seat
  • Welcome Retract function
  • Wireless phone charger
  • Auto-dimming IRVM
  • Automatic climate control
  • 540-degree surround-view camera
  • Six terrain modes

Features Verdict

When comparing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V, the Sierra EV impresses with its futuristic triple-screen cabin and longer range, while the Harrier EV stands out for its advanced ADAS technology, autonomous parking functions, and premium convenience features.

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V: Price Comparison

For most buyers, pricing is one of the biggest deciding factors, and that’s exactly where the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V comparison starts to get interesting.

ModelStarting Price (Ex-showroom)
Tata Sierra EV₹18.79 lakh
Tata Harrier EV₹21.49 lakh

The Tata Sierra EV starts at ₹18.79 lakh (ex-showroom), making it around ₹2.7 lakh more affordable than the Harrier EV. This aggressive pricing gives the Sierra EV a strong value advantage, especially for buyers who want a premium electric SUV with modern technology and an impressive driving range without crossing the ₹20 lakh mark.

The Harrier EV, meanwhile, justifies its higher price with a significantly more powerful dual-motor setup, advanced Level 2 ADAS, Auto Park Assist, and premium convenience features aimed at buyers looking for a flagship EV experience.

Final Verdict: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V

The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V comparison proves that Tata Motors has built two excellent electric SUVs with different personalities instead of creating direct rivals.

The Tata Sierra EV shines as the smarter value proposition. It delivers a longer claimed range, a distinctive triple-screen cabin, and a more accessible starting price, making it an ideal choice for families and buyers looking for a premium EV without stretching their budget.

On the other hand, the Tata Harrier EV is the performance flagship. Its 390 bhp Quad Wheel Drive setup, Level 2 ADAS, Auto Park Assist, and additional premium features make it the better option for enthusiasts who want cutting-edge technology and stronger performance.

In the end, the Tata Sierra EV vs Tata Harrier EV debate doesn’t have a one-size-fits-all answer. If range, affordability, and value are your priorities, the Sierra EV is the clear winner. But if you want maximum power, advanced safety systems, and the most feature-rich Tata electric SUV, the Harrier EV justifies its premium price.
